About

Lucis is a Paris-based preventive health platform that pairs comprehensive blood biomarker testing with an AI companion called Lucy, designed for consumers who want to spot risk factors before symptoms appear. Members get a blood draw at a partner laboratory, and the platform analyses more than 110 biomarkers , returning personalized protocols covering nutrition, training, supplementation, and retesting cadence, all reviewed by an in-house medical team. The product is aimed at people frustrated by reactive care and priced out of private longevity clinics that can run into tens of thousands of euros per year. The launch matters because Lucis just closed a $20M Series A led by Singular with participation from General Catalyst and Y Combinator, arriving four months after the company's $8.5M seed in December 2025 and bringing total funding to roughly $28m . The capital will fund expansion into Spain, Germany and Italy by the end of 2026 and continued development of the AI layer that turns biomarker data into ongoing health guidance. The company positions Lucy as a longitudinal companion that learns from each test cycle, surfacing patterns across diet, sleep, training, and supplementation rather than producing one-off lab reports. Lucis was founded in 2025 by Maxime Berthelot, Baptiste Debever and Max Guérois, and went through Y Combinator's 2025 batch. The founders describe Lucis as the product they wished existed during their own searches for answers, with Baptiste having lost a close relative to a condition that could have been caught earlier and the team having spent years self-experimenting with biomarker tracking. The bet is that Europe is ready for a consumer preventive health category sitting between standard primary care and elite longevity clinics, and that an AI layer over routine blood work is the wedge.
